Coronavirus UK: Students in Manchester claim they are being ‘penned in’ with metal fences

Students in Manchester today raged about being ‘penned in’ after metal fences were ominously erected around their halls on the first day of England’s new shutdown. Covid lockdown: Panic buyers strip shelves of toilet roll and pasta

Swathes of customers raced to bulk-buy household essentials this morning ahead of a second national lockdown next week. Supermarket shelves across the UK were emptied of loo roll, pasta and tinned goods as desperate Britons prepared to hunker down at home for the next month.
